Rollers, GU unpaid after HeForShe participation
Thursday, July 27, 2017
Rollers and Gaborone United (GU) women’s sides played a curtain raiser to the main match between Platinum Stars and Rollers men’s sides. Rollers women’s team was to be paid P20,000 after defeating their cross town rivals, GU 1-0 in that match. GU were to pocket P10,000 for their participation. However, up to now, both sides are yet to receive their payments.
While Rollers point fingers at IWG for the delay, IWG on the other hand blame Rollers who they say were partners in organising the tournament. IWG marketing and public relations manager, Boitumelo Kenosi told Mmegi Sport yesterday that they were in partnership with Township Rollers who were responsible for the technical aspect of the tournament. “IWG is not responsible for crediting the prize money. Township Rollers were the ones responsible for the technical aspect,” Kenosi said. “Therefore, they should have paid the teams by now.”
